----Source: NEILLSVILLE TIMES (Neillsville, Clark County, Wis.) 01/16/1908

Selves, Donald #2 (1884? - 10 JAN 1908)

Last Friday an exceptionally sad accident occurred at Minneapolis in which Donald Selves, a son of Mr. and Mrs. Elmer Selves, met his death. Selves had been employed for the past four years in the yards of the Minnesota railroad Transfer Co., his duties being principally to switch freight cars about the yards. Friday Selves was assisting in switching cars and had thrown a switch at the bottom of a heavy grade. He apparently did not notice the freight car coming down the grade and he was caught under the wheels, his head and chest being terribly crushed. Death was instantaneous. Telegrams were immediately sent to Selves’ relatives and his parents, grandmother, Mrs. John Selves, brother Byron of Fond du Lac and Mrs. H. W. Brown went to Minneapolis at once. The funeral was held there Monday.

Donald Selves was born in Neillsville (Clark Co., Wis.) and was 24 years of age. He was a young man of unusual abilities and industry and had the highest esteem of all his acquaintances. He was capable and honorable, and the sad accident terminated a life of promise and usefulness. He was married three years ago and to the bereaved wife and relatives the deepest expressions of sympathy are extended.
